Le Petit Nice Passédat

The most exclusive hotel in Marseille with two separate villas round the coast from the centre. Views gaze out on the Château d’If and chef, Gerald Passedat, has two Michelin stars.

New Hotel Vieux-port

Stylish, modern looking hotel whose rooms have tastefully designed African and Asian themes. The view looking out over the vieux port is stunning.

Le Ryad

Excellent Moroccan-style hotel that has stylish rooms and a lovely outside patio for early evening drinks. There are only ten rooms, adding to the intimacy.

Hotel Le Corbusier

On one of the floors of pioneering 1950s modernist building, La Cité Radieuse, and offering spectacular views of the mountains and the Marseille sprawl.

Les Acanthes

Charming bed and breakfast situated only 15 minutes from the historic centre of Marseille’s Vieux Port.
You can choose either a quiet bedroom or a small apartment, former hunting lodge dating from the XVIIth century.
Here you are close to all the joys of the sea, pebbled beaches, golfing, concerts in Marseille, Aix en Provence or la Roque-d’Antheron, go to the theatre in Avignon, visit the city of Popes, or if you prefer, spend a calm and relaxing evening in the garden.
